The rise of remote and flexible work options

The workplace is evolving. Remote and flexible work options have surged in popularity, reshaping how we think about employment.

More companies are embracing the idea that productivity doesn’t require a rigid office environment. This shift allows employees to choose where they work best, whether it’s from home or a cozy café.

Flexibility also means adapting hours to fit personal lifestyles. Parents can manage school schedules better, while night owls can tackle projects when they’re most alert.

This transformation has opened doors for talent across geographical boundaries. Employers now seek skills rather than proximity, leading to a more diverse workforce.

Challenges remain, of course. Maintaining communication and team cohesion requires intentional effort in this new landscape. Yet, as businesses adapt, the possibilities are expanding rapidly for both employers and job seekers alike.

The impact of technology on job opportunities

Technology is reshaping job opportunities at a rapid pace. Automation and artificial intelligence are transforming traditional roles, making some jobs obsolete while creating new ones.

With these advancements, companies can streamline operations, reducing costs and increasing efficiency. This shift allows them to focus on areas that require human creativity and problem-solving skills.

Virtual reality and augmented reality are emerging tools for training and development, offering immersive experiences that enhance learning outcomes. These innovations open doors for new positions in tech-driven industries.

Moreover, technology facilitates remote work options, allowing talent from around the globe to collaborate seamlessly. Businesses can access a diverse workforce without geographical limitations.

As we embrace these changes, adaptability becomes essential. Workers who continually upskill will find greater prospects in this evolving landscape of employment.

The growing demand for skilled workers in emerging industries

Emerging industries are transforming job landscapes at a rapid pace. As technology advances, sectors like renewable energy, artificial intelligence, and biotechnology are exploding with opportunities. Companies in these fields require talent equipped with specialized skills.

The demand for workers proficient in coding, data analysis, and digital marketing is skyrocketing. Traditional roles are evolving or becoming obsolete as new technologies reshape business operations. Those who can adapt will find themselves in high demand.

Educational institutions recognize this shift and are tailoring programs to meet industry needs. Upskilling and reskilling initiatives have become crucial for workers wanting to stay relevant.

Moreover, the emphasis on soft skills cannot be overlooked. Communication, critical thinking, and adaptability now complement technical expertise as essential attributes sought by employers in emerging sectors. The workforce must evolve alongside these dynamic industries to seize the available opportunities ahead.

How to stay competitive in the job market

Staying competitive in the job market requires a proactive approach. First, invest time in continuous learning. Online courses and certifications can enhance your skills and keep you relevant.

Networking plays a crucial role too. Attend industry events, join professional groups online, and connect with peers on platforms like LinkedIn. Building relationships often opens doors to new opportunities.

Adaptability is essential as well. Be open to change and willing to embrace new technologies or work processes that emerge within your field.

Soft skills are equally important. Communication, teamwork, and problem-solving abilities set you apart from others who may have similar technical expertise.

Showcase your achievements effectively through an updated resume or portfolio. Highlighting quantifiable results can make a significant impact on potential employers looking for value-driven candidates.

The role of freelancing and entrepreneurship in the future of work

Freelancing and entrepreneurship are reshaping the future of work in significant ways. As traditional job structures evolve, more individuals seek autonomy over their careers.

Freelancing provides flexibility that many crave in today’s fast-paced world. It allows professionals to choose projects aligned with their skills and interests. This shift empowers creativity and innovation.

Entrepreneurship also plays a vital role; it encourages problem-solving and adaptability. Startups often emerge from the gigs freelancers undertake, leading to new business opportunities.

Additionally, platforms connecting freelancers with clients thrive as demand for specialized services grows. Many companies prefer hiring experts on a project basis rather than maintaining full-time staff.

As we look ahead, this trend will likely expand further, fostering a diverse workforce equipped for change. Embracing freelancing or entrepreneurial ventures can open doors to unforeseen possibilities while redefining success in the modern economy.
